Quincy Owusu-Abeyie has been named in Ghana's starting line up for the opening African Cup of Nations match against Guinea. Claude Le Roy has also handed Eric Addo a defensive role as he partners team captain, John Mensah in central defence. Junior Agogo and Asamoah lead Ghana's attack. Ghana play Guinea in the tournament's first match at the Ohene Djan Stadium with kick off at 17:00GMT. Ghana line up: Richard Kinsgon, John Paintsil, Hans Adu Sarpei, Eric Addo, John Mensah, Michael Essien, Laryea Kingston, Quincy Owusu-Abeyie, Sulley Muntari, Asamoah Gyan and Junior Agogo. Subs: Sammy Adjei, Haminu Draman, Nana Kwasi Asare, Harrison Afful, Alhassan Illiasu, Anthony Annan, Bernard Kumordzi, Andre Ayew, Baffuor Gyan, Kwadwo Asamoah and Fatau Duada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
